Hi team — handing over the Fernpost release. The big change this cycle is the new encoding detector for uploaded text files: it now samples the first 64 KB, falls back to Latin-1 only when confidence is below threshold, and logs the decision per upload. Watch for regressions in the Bramleigh tenant, which sends mixed-encoding CSVs. The detector bundle ships as a signed artifact, and verification in staging requires the deploy key that appears directly below this paragraph.

deploy key for kafof-kaguf: bky9_WnPyu8S2E

Subject: Acquisition discussion — Quenholt Labs

Team,

As our incoming director joins next week, a quick update: talks with Quenholt Labs have moved to a second diligence round. Their Marrow toolkit fills our analytics gap, and their Ostvale team would transfer intact. Valuation range is still open. The strategic rationale is summarized below.

internal memo for tajof-kagef: The western region missed its Ulaius quota by 32.0 percent last quarter. Kasoxek Freight plans to lower the Eliiel list price by 64.7 percent in November. The board signed off on a budget of $266.8 million for Project Istwyn. The renewal with Wenmirix Logistics closes at $502.9 million a year, 11.8 percent below the last contract.

**Mgmt Meeting Minutes — Retiring the Brightline Range**

Quick recap for sales leads at Fenholt Supplies: we agreed to retire the Brightline fixture range by year-end. Remaining stock moves to clearance pricing next month, and accounts on standing orders get migrated to the Lumetta range. Trade-in incentives were approved in principle. The confidential note on next steps sits just below.

board note of bajof-bajeg: The pricing group signed off on a budget of $13.4 million for Project Sildor. The renewal with Lamixek Holdings closes at $48.9 million a year, 49 percent above the last contract.

## Getting Started with SquatSentry

Welcome! SquatSentry scans our internal registry for typo-squatting packages — think `requesst` instead of the real thing. Findings land in the Gatefold review queue, where you triage them as malicious, benign, or noise. To run a scan locally, point the CLI at the staging registry and authenticate. The key for the staging scanner endpoint is right below.

service key, yadug-bajog: zpat3_pou